We’re breaking down Michigan’s trip to Europe to focus on every player on the roster. Each look-back dives deep into the stats, video, and performance throughout the trip, with one eye on the season—which is just two months away.
Today we look at junior forward JP Estrella, who averaged 11.7 points and 4.3 rebounds per game in his first action since transferring to Michigan from Tennessee.
JP Estrella was one of two starters to feature in every game on the trip, and his performance was a bit up and down. He didn’t produce much in the opener against Lithuania, was far more effective against the reserve team, then had an efficient but foul-plagued night against Mega Superbet.
